Havells India Limited has successfully resolved its ongoing disputes with the HPL Group, culminating in a Settlement Agreement signed on November 8, 2025. This agreement addresses all pending litigations regarding the use of the 'HAVELLS' trademark, which had been the subject of various court cases, including those in the Delhi High Court and the Supreme Court. Under the terms of the settlement, the HPL Group has acknowledged Havells India's exclusive rights to the trademark since 1971 and has agreed to cease any claims or challenges related to the 'HAVELLS' mark. Furthermore, HPL Group will rebrand its entities to eliminate the use of 'HAVELLS' in their names.

As part of the settlement, Havells India will make a one-time payment of Rs. 129.60 crores to the HPL Group. This resolution not only brings closure to the legal disputes but also strengthens Havells India's brand integrity moving forward.
